Descripción
Sumario:Spread-spectrum techniques for improving Electromagnetic Compatibilities are investigated. This requires generating Constant Envelope Wideband signals. We produce them via chaotic maps that yield pseudo random time series, used afterwards to modulate sinusoidal waves in frequency. How to assess a maps's suitability for such task is also discussed. © 2011-12 by IJAMAS, CESER Publications.
